Moran First Graders Visit Their Pen Pals at Bittersweet
Bittersweet and Moran first graders have been forming new friendships through a pen pals program that connects students from both schools. Throughout the school year, the students exchanged letters, learning about each other’s hobbies, families, and school experiences.
Today, the Moran students had the chance to meet their Bittersweet pen pals in person during an exciting visit.
The day’s highlight was a trip to the PHM Arthur M. Klinger Planetarium, where the students watched an engaging show about our Solar System.

They learned about planets, stars, and other celestial wonders while deepening their connections with their new friends. This collaboration between the schools encourages writing skills, curiosity about the world, and the joy of new friendships.

Running is Elementary 2024 is in the Books!
The “Running is Elementary” program wrapped up its 2024 season with the main race at Elm Road Elementary School yesterday. The event saw enthusiastic participation from 4th and 5th grade students, both boys and girls, who competed in a 1-mile course that tested their endurance and speed.
The annual program, aimed at promoting fitness and healthy lifestyles among elementary school students, brought together participants from various schools in the area.

Parents and teachers cheered from the sidelines as students dashed toward the finish line, each striving to put forth their best effort. The event not only highlighted the physical capabilities of the students but also emphasized the importance of physical education in the school curriculum.

The “Running is Elementary” program has been a key event in the community’s calendar for the last 15 years, fostering a sense of unity and encouraging children to adopt active lifestyles. Special thanks to the P-H-M Education Foundation for making it possible!

Greg Trytko named as the inaugural Culver’s Bus Driver of the Month
We’re happy to introduce you to PHM bus driver Greg Trytko as the inaugural Culver’s Bus Driver of the Month!!!
Greg drives Bus #117 for Moran Elementary. Greg is a ’78 Penn grad and has been with PHM for going on seven years. Greg is praised for his positive attitude & willingness to cover extra routes when needed.
So far this school year, he has completed 41 field & athletics trips–adding up to almost 250 hours! The PHM Transportation Department is beyond grateful for Greg! Thank you Culver’s and P-H-M Education Foundation for being valued partners.

Moran March Madness a Huge Success!
On Friday, March 17th, 2023, our Parent Teacher Association hosted Moran March Madness!
Moran March Madness is one of our major fundraisers that supports our goal of enriching the educational experience here at Moran.
This event was about more than raising money though, it was also about bringing the community together.
For four hours, teams across grade levels competed in a tournament-style competition.
